Table Spoons (pair) - Hanoverian Pattern - Edinburgh 1759 by John Clark - 21.5cm long; 147g combined weight - PW/5505a
These are an outstanding pair of mid-18th century Scottish silver table spoons in superb condition.
The original, thick bowl tips immediately illustrate the fine, heavy quality of the pieces and their excellent state of preservation. The reverse terminals bear original engraved ciphers and the Hanoverian stems have long heels to the underside of the bowls.
The Edinburgh hallmarks are extremely crisp too with clear 1759 date letters (gothic style "E") and the maker's CLARK surname in full. John Clark was working in Edinburgh between 1751 and 1771. An excellent pair of silver table spoons!
